Auburn ranks among top public universities in the nation
Chris King
September 23, 2008

For the 16th consecutive year, Auburn University has been chosen by US News & World Report as one of the top 50 public universities in the nation. Auburn is ranked 28th among land grant universities.

The College of Business and the Samuel Ginn College of Engineering also earned individual honors. The College of Business was ranked 30th among public universities and 52nd nationally, while the College of Engineering was ranked 51st nationally and 34th among public universities offering doctoral programs.
